Composite Number

6383

6383 is a odd composite number that follows 6382 and precedes 6384. It is composed of 4 distinct factors: 1, 13, 491, 6383. Its prime factorization can be written as 13 × 491. 6383 is classified as a deficient number based on the sum of its proper divisors. In computer science, 6383 is represented as 1100011101111 in binary and 18EF in hexadecimal.
